Here's a look at some common issues you might encounter with your Kawasaki KSR Pro 2014, along with some troubleshooting tips to get you back on the road. First up, starting problems. If your KSR Pro is having trouble starting, there are a few things to check. Make sure the battery is fully charged and in good condition. Check the spark plug to see if it's fouled or damaged. Also, inspect the fuel system for any clogs or blockages. Make sure the fuel valve is turned on and that the fuel lines are free of any obstructions. If the engine cranks but won't start, the issue could be a faulty ignition coil or a problem with the carburetor. Another common issue is engine stalling. If your KSR Pro stalls unexpectedly, there could be several causes. Check the idle speed; it might be set too low. Inspect the fuel system for any air leaks. Make sure the air filter is clean. If the engine stalls at high speeds, you may need to adjust the carburetor's jetting. Keep an eye on the exhaust smoke. If you notice any excessive smoke from the exhaust, it could indicate a problem. Blue smoke often suggests burning oil, which could mean worn piston rings or valve seals. Black smoke usually indicates a rich fuel mixture, potentially due to a clogged air filter or a carburetor issue. White smoke could be a sign of coolant leaking into the combustion chamber.
Next, the electrical system. Electrical problems can be frustrating, but they're often easily fixed. Check the fuses to ensure they haven't blown. Inspect the wiring for any loose connections or damage. If the lights or indicators aren't working, check the bulbs and replace them if needed. Pay attention to the brakes! Make sure the brake pads aren't worn. Check the brake fluid level and top it up if necessary. Check the brakes for any leaks. Squealing brakes can often be resolved by cleaning the brake pads or rotors. Another area to look at is the suspension and handling. If you experience poor handling or a bumpy ride, inspect the suspension components for damage or leaks. Check the tire pressure and adjust it to the recommended levels. Ensure the chain is properly lubricated and adjusted. Finally, look at the transmission and clutch. If the gear shifting is difficult or the clutch is slipping, you may need to adjust the clutch cable or check the clutch plates. Make sure you regularly lubricate and maintain the chain to ensure smooth shifting. Remember, regular maintenance is key to preventing many of these issues. Maintenance Tips for Your Kawasaki KSR Pro 2014: Keeping It in Tip-Top Shape
Alright, guys and gals, let's talk about keeping your Kawasaki KSR Pro 2014 in tip-top shape. Regular maintenance is not just about preventing problems; it's about maximizing your fun and extending the life of your awesome mini-moto. So, here's a breakdown of essential maintenance tips that will keep your KSR Pro running smoothly for years to come. One of the most important things is regular oil changes. The oil lubricates the engine's moving parts, reduces friction, and prevents overheating. Change the oil and filter according to the manufacturer's recommendations, usually every few thousand miles or as indicated in your owner's manual. Be sure to use the recommended type and grade of oil. Next, we have the chain maintenance. The chain transfers power from the engine to the rear wheel, so it must be kept clean, lubricated, and properly adjusted. Regularly clean the chain with a chain cleaner and apply chain lubricant. Inspect the chain for wear and tear, and adjust the tension as needed. A well-maintained chain will ensure smooth power delivery and prevent premature wear. Next, there are the spark plugs. The spark plug ignites the air-fuel mixture in the engine, so it's essential to keep it in good condition. Check the spark plug regularly, and replace it according to the manufacturer's recommendations. A new spark plug can improve engine performance and fuel efficiency. Don't forget the air filter! A clean air filter is essential for optimal engine performance. The air filter prevents dirt and debris from entering the engine. Inspect the air filter regularly and clean or replace it as needed. A clogged air filter can reduce engine power and fuel efficiency. Also, don't forget to check the brakes! Regular brake maintenance is crucial for safety. Inspect the brake pads for wear and replace them if necessary. Check the brake fluid level and top it up as needed. Ensure the brake system is free of leaks, and bleed the brakes if necessary to remove any air bubbles. Then, we have the tires! The tires are the only point of contact between your bike and the road, so they must be in good condition. Check the tire pressure regularly and inflate it to the recommended levels. Inspect the tires for any signs of wear and tear, such as cuts or bulges, and replace them if necessary. Don't forget to check all the fluids! Check the coolant level regularly and top it up as needed. Inspect the brake fluid and clutch fluid for any leaks. And make sure to visually inspect your bike regularly. Look for any loose bolts, leaks, or other signs of damage. Keep an eye on any unusual noises or vibrations. Regular visual inspections can help you catch problems early and prevent more significant issues down the line. Finally, remember to follow the maintenance schedule in your owner's manual. This schedule provides detailed instructions on how often to perform each maintenance task.
